Release checklist — GridSmith crossword generator: confirm the fill engine produces no duplicate answers across rotationally symmetric grids, and that the banned-word list from the Hollowvale content team is loaded before generation, not after. Reviewer should spot-check ten puzzles at each difficulty tier and verify clue numbering matches grid coordinates exactly. Run the determinism suite twice with the same seed and diff the outputs; any mismatch blocks release. Once both runs match, paste the verification token immediately below this line.

session token of tajef-bageg = htk21_5d90d574934f3ccae6437

## Changelog — TidePeek widget v3.1

Heads up, plugin folks: we changed the defaults. Refresh cadence is shorter, the harmonic model now defaults to the newer Wrenholm tables, and the widget caches predictions client-side. If your plugin pinned the old values, nothing breaks — but new installs behave differently. The new default configuration ships as follows.

deployment values, kajep-kageg:
[praix]
host = praix.paliqcorp.corp
user = praix_svc
database = praix_prod

Briefing: Retirement of the Skellan Product Line

For the incoming director. Skellan units are end-of-life effective Q2. Margins fell below threshold three quarters running. Remaining stock moves through the Bryelle outlet channel. Support obligations run eighteen months; Tomas owns the wind-down plan. Two engineers transfer to the Vantrell programme. No public announcement until distributors are notified. Read the confidential note below before the review.

confidential, bahof-yaweg: Headcount on the Kaseth team goes from 32 to 109 by the end of January. Gross margin on Kaseth came in at 46 percent against a plan of 45 percent.

The Huewatch audit endpoint scans rendered pages for color-contrast failures against configurable thresholds and returns per-element ratios. As a contractor, you will call the sandbox instance only; production access requires a separate review. All requests must include the sandbox service key, which you will find directly below.

service key, fawip-bajef: kto11_Qt5wZK9vdNC